Получить доступ
Эксклюзивный партнер
Skillbox в Беларуси
burger
Каталог Программирование Введение ­в программирова­ние

Введение ­в программирова­ние

Вы изучите основные профессии в сфере IT: Frontend-разработчик, Java-разработчик, Python-разработчик, тестировщик, специалист по кибербезопасности, специалист по Data Science, iOS-разработчик и Android-разработчик. Разберётесь, где и для чего используются различные языки программирования и примените их на практике: напишете сайт и простые программы. В конце курса пройдёте тест на профориентацию. Поймёте, какая профессия подходит именно вам.

IT — это перспективно

На рынке не хватает IT-специалистов

По данным rabota.by

Сложно ли научиться программировать?

Многие думают, что IT — это сфера для «избранных», а без технического образования и хорошего английского там делать нечего. Но это совсем не так! Наш курс поможет разобраться, что действительно нужно знать и уметь IT-специалисту, и развеет популярные мифы о сфере.

На курсе вы узнаете о самых востребованных IT-профессиях:

  • Разработчики создают программы для цифровых устройств — от смартфонов до умных домов. Для этого они используют языки программирования, например, Java, Python, JavaScript, Swift, Kotlin.
  • Специалисты по анализу данных, или дата-сайентисты, ищут закономерности в больших массивах данных с помощью специально обученных моделей — нейросетей. Такие модели, например, помогают врачам быстрее диагностировать опухоли, а полиции — опознавать преступников в толпе.
  • Специалисты по кибербезопасности защищают данные пользователей и компаний от злоумышленников и предотвращают хакерские атаки.
  • Инженеры по тестированию проверяют качество программ и ищут ошибки в коде. Делать это можно как вручную, так и с помощью инструментов автоматизации.

На курсе вы

  • IT-специальности

    Изучите работу Frontend-разработчика, Java-разработчика, Python-разработчика, тестировщика, специалиста по кибербезопасности, специалиста по Data Science, iOS-разработчика и Android-разработчика.

  • Устройство компьютера

    Познакомитесь с устройством компьютера, типами памяти и обмена данных.

  • Основы программирования

    Изучите, как выглядит код и попробуете создать свой на практике.

  • Различия и сходства

    Сможете различать backend от frontend, C++ от C#. Изучите технологии, необходимые для DevOps-инженеров, специалистов по кибербезопасности, iOS- и Android-программистов.

  • Несложные программы и веб-страницы

    Напишете сайт с применением HTML и CSS, таймер на JavaScript. Создадите простые программы на Python и Java, также приложения на Android и iOS с возможностью смены темы.

Пройдите тест и найдите профессию, которая подойдёт именно вам

В конце курса вас ждёт профориентационный тест. Пройдите его и узнайте, какие направления и языки программирования подходят вам больше всего.

Заполните заявку — и ссылка на бесплатный доступ к курсу с тестом придёт на ваш email.

Как проходит обучение на платформе

  • Регистрация

    Присоединяетесь к Skillbox

    Бесплатный доступ к личному кабинету откроется сразу после подачи заявки на курс. Все видео доступны вам навсегда, посмотреть их можно в любое время.

  • Теория и практика

    Начинаете учиться

    Спикер доступным языком рассказывает о каждом направлении в IT, разбирает код и объясняет материал на понятных примерах. Знания можно закрепить на практических работах под видео.

  • Профориентация

    Проходите онлайн-тест

    Отвечаете на вопросы и получаете рекомендации по дальнейшему развитию. Вы узнаете свои сильные стороны и сможете осознанно выбрать курс для идеального старта в IT.

Содержание курса

Вы узнаете о востребованных IT-профессиях, получите доступное объяснение принципов программирования и сами сможете написать простые проекты.

  • 1 месяц обучения
  • 17 тематических модулей
  1. Первый шаг к программированию

    Познакомитесь со спикером курса и услышите несколько историй о ребятах, которые освоили программирование с нуля.

  2. Программы повсюду

    Узнаете, где вообще нужны программы и для каких целей.

  3. Программирование — это просто

    Разберётесь, из чего состоит код и по каким принципам его пишут. Узнаете, обязательно ли знать математику или заканчивать технический вуз, чтобы стать программистом.

  4. Программирование — это перспективно

    Узнаете, на какие зарплаты можно рассчитывать сейчас и в будущем, изучите тенденции рынка и варианты трудоустройства.

  5. Разнообразие IT-направлений

    Познакомитесь с самыми востребованными IT-специальностями и поймёте, чем ещё занимаются разработчики и другие IT-специалисты, кроме написания кода.

  6. Устройства и программы

    Поймёте, как работают операционные системы, как устроены компьютер и другие устройства, для которых разработчики создают программы.

  7. От теории к практике

    Узнаете, чем будете заниматься в следующих модулях, и подготовитесь к простым практическим работам. Небольшая практика в разных направлениях поможет понять, какая IT-профессия вам ближе.

  8. Frontend-разработка

    Любой сайт или веб-приложение состоят из 2 частей: frontend (интерфейс, который мы видим в браузере и с которым взаимодействуем) и backend (серверная часть). В этом уроке вы познакомитесь с профессией frontend-разработчика на практике. Создадите простую веб-страницу с использованием HTML, CSS и JavaScript.

  9. Разработка на Java

    На протяжении 20 лет язык Java занимает первые строчки во всех рейтингах языков программирования. Спрос на Java-разработчиков постоянно растёт. Вы узнаете, где и для чего применяется Java, изучите основы этого языка и напишете небольшую программу.

  10. Разработка на Python

    На Python пишут всё — от софта для умного дома и чат-ботов до backend и нейросетей. Он заслужил доверие разработчиков и стал популярным за счёт своей простоты. Вы убедитесь в этом, когда выполните несколько практических работ в рамках этого урока.

  11. Тестирование (QA)

    Любая программа нуждается в тщательной проверке перед тем, как попасть в руки пользователей. В этом уроке вы попробуете сделать ручное и автоматизированное тестирование приложений, которые вы разработали ранее.

  12. Кибербезопасность

    Бизнес нуждается в специалистах, которые предотвращают взломы, атаки и защищают данные от злоумышленников. В этом уроке мы поговорим о некоторых аспектах и особенностях обеспечения безопасности данных и приложений.

  13. Data science

    Нейросети помогают бизнесу принимать решения, строят прогнозы и рекомендуют товары в интернет-магазинах. Всё это было бы невозможным без анализа данных, специальных алгоритмов и механизмов работы с данными. Несколько таких алгоритмов и механизмов мы изучим на практике в этом уроке.

  14. Разработка iOS-приложений

    Мобильные разработчики упрощают рутинные задачи. Благодаря им мы можем прямо со смартфона вызвать такси, заказать еду или пообщаться с родственниками по видеосвязи. В этом уроке вы узнаете, как создать приложение для устройств Apple на языке программирования Swift.

  15. Разработка Android-приложений

    70% всех смартфонов в мире работают на Android. В этом уроке вы узнаете, как создавать приложения для такой огромной аудитории, и попрактикуетесь в программировании на Kotlin.

  16. Тест на профориентацию

    Пройдёте небольшой тест от Skillbox и выясните, в каких IT-направлениях вы добьётесь успеха.

  17. Гид по платформе и трудоустройству

    Познакомитесь с форматами обучения на платформе Skillbox — курсами и профессиями. Узнаете, как Центр карьеры помогает устроиться на работу, и познакомитесь со списком компаний-партнёров, где ждут участников курсов.

Записаться на курс или получить бесплатную консультацию
Имя
Телефон
Электронная почта
Отправить
Ознакомиться с условиями публичного договора
success
error
warning

Кто ведёт курс?

Даниил
Пилипенко
Java-программист с опытом работы 18 лет, директор центра по подбору персонала SymbioWay

Выпускник МГУ имени М. В. Ломоносова, кандидат наук. Владеет Java, PHP, технологиями frontend-разработки. 2006–2012. Руководитель отдела разработки в издательстве «Вокруг Света». 2012–2013. Ведущий разработчик Ютинет.Ру, создавал портал и внешние сервисы проекта. 2013–2014. Руководитель разработки PilotCards, управлял командой, которая создавала веб-сайт и мобильные приложения под iOS и Android. Автор курсов, спикер и программный директор направления backend-разработки в Skillbox.

Профиль на LinkedIn

о Skillbox

Отзывы участников, которые пришли в IT вместе со Skillbox

Отзывы студентов Иван Медведев, г. Ивантеевка Курс «Профессия Инженер по тестированию»
Если какой-то материал тяжело даётся, есть вопрос по ДЗ, достаточно написать преподавателю, который поможет разобраться с информацией и подскажет, как решить задачу.По итогу 9-месячной учёбы стал по-другому смотреть на сайты. Замечаю «баги», разбираюсь в вёрстке, веду репорты. Узнал, как работать со специфическим ПО.Уже сейчас нисколько не жалею, что выбрал Skillbox. Спасибо!!!
Микаил Азизов Курс «Python Basic»
Нравятся интересные задачи и видео длиной в 10 минут (а не час, что может надоесть). Возможно, спикер успевает рассказать не всё, а только главное, но есть другие ресурсы: книги, YouTube, форумы и, конечно же, Telegram-чат.
Записаться на курс
0 BYN
Скидка по промокоду:
check Бесплатный курс от Skillbox
Введение ­в программирова­ние
Длительность: 1 мес
Заполните контактные данные
Имя
Телефон
E-mail
Название компании
Отправить заявку
Ознакомиться с условиями публичного договора
success
error
warning

Часто задаваемые вопросы

  • Я ничего не понимаю в IT-технологиях. Этот курс поможет мне разобраться?
    Конечно! Мы создали этот курс специально для тех, кто хочет получить востребованную IT-профессию, но не знает, с чего начать. Вы познакомитесь с технологиями, языками программирования и IT-специальностями, а ещё — сможете понять, какая профессия вам подходит больше.
  • На этом курсе будет практика? Я смогу после обучения сменить профессию?
    Это ознакомительный бесплатный курс. Здесь мы рассказываем о современных IT-профессиях и помогаем выбрать подходящую специальность. На этом курсе нет мощной практики, но есть ознакомительные практические задания для каждого IT-направления. Если вы хотите стать разработчиком и готовы начать обучение — присмотритесь к курсам Skillbox по программированию.
  • Сомневаюсь, что смогу стать программистом. Есть ли какие-то ограничения?
    Никаких. Научиться программировать можно в любом возрасте — курсы Skillbox заканчивают люди и старше 30 лет. Кроме того, не нужно знать математику или иметь опыт написания кода. Программистами становятся машинисты поездов, стилисты, гончары.
  • Не верю в то, что после курса можно найти работу. У меня ведь не будет опыта.
    Во-первых, каждому слушателю годовой программы Skillbox помогают с трудоустройством: оформление резюме, подбор лучших вакансий, назначение собеседования.

    Во-вторых, на каждом курсе вы будете делать проекты по брифам от компаний-партнёров и собирать портфолио. Задачи на курсе максимально приближены к реальным. Ваши работы сыграют решающую роль при трудоустройстве — спрос на IT-специалистов настолько высок, что компании обращают внимание на портфолио, а не на стаж.Кстати, 88% пользователей Skillbox находят работу до конца обучения.
  • Я смогу совмещать курс с работой? Сколько часов надо уделять занятиям?
    Да, совмещать учебу и работу получится, потому что вы решаете, когда смотреть уроки. В среднем пользователи Skillbox уделяют учебе от трёх до пяти часов в неделю.
  • Полученных знаний хватит для трудоустройства?
    «Курсы» — это короткие программы, которые направлены на освоение конкретного навыка или инструмента. Полностью изучить специальность помогают программы «Профессий».
  • Как я буду общаться с куратором?
    Эксперт будет проверять и комментировать практические работы, давать советы, а на вопросы ответит ментор в Telegram-чате.
  • Не могу оплатить курс сразу. Есть альтернативы?
    Да: рассрочка. Сумму разделят на ежемесячные платежи.
  • Если курс не подойдёт, что делать?
    Вам вернут 50% от уплаченной суммы, при условии, если вы обратитесь за возвратом денежных средств в течение 30 дней с даты предоставления доступа к модулю. По истечении 30 дней с даты предоставления доступа к модулю возврат денежных средств не осуществляется.